White Label Seeds: Popular marijuana strains by Sensi

White Label Seeds comes out of the Netherlands and is connected to Sensi Seeds. It was set up as a way to make their genetics easier to get without making people spend too much. The range is broad. You can find feminized seeds, regular seeds, and autoflowering strains. The point is simple. They keep the cost down but the seeds are still solid, which is what most growers want.

Quick Facts
Location: Netherlands
Focus: Budget friendly strains with stable genetics
Types Available: Feminized, regular, autoflowering
Well Known For: White Widow, White Skunk, Ice, Purple Haze, Northern Lights, Super Skunk
Works Well For: Growers who want dependable strains at fair prices
